My review is mixed. I stayed at this hotel, but in a timeshare owned by someone else who had completely remodeled the room from floor to ceiling. My room was wonderful. The staff seemed accommodating for the few times I came in contact like opening the entrance doors for everyone and greeting you. The location is easy to find. The parking deck is tight, dilapidated and especially eerie at night. If you have to park on the last level there are no lights from vehicle to elevator. I would not want to park a truck or large suv in this garage. The turns/tunnels going up each level are tight and low! The upper and first level may be better for parking a big vehicle but in between is questionable. I would sweat parking a 2500 truck. Clearance in 6 ft 6 in tunnels navigating up deck. I stayed on the 16th floor, very top! I could still hear the band playing sporadically til 11pm nightly even with air conditioning and fan going so I imagine floors below are likely to hear more so and especially ocean view rooms. The property itself isn’t very clean. The halls are hot and humid outside rooms, carpets stained throughout. Signs stating where vending or ice is located are outdated and some machines don’t appear to have been serviced in ages and are empty. The lazy river is very small, more than 4 people and it would feel very crowded. I thought the pool seemed small also especially for a 16 floor hotel with a busy open to beach bar. Cockroach at enclosed pool area! It was huge! Cockroach also on beach just a few feet from hotel when I went walking the first morning! A capped syringe next to hotel trashcan on beach lying in the sand. Didn’t get picture of that. Two dead birds on property which also disturbed me a bit. Lots of trash and broken glass on beach in this area so make your little ones wear shoes and caution digging in sand! Luckily I was on a girls trip with no kids. Honestly would have ventured with kids to a better beach area. Lots of drinking adults even after labor day so I can’t imagine prior to this. I would caution bringing kids here due to the busyness of the beach areas, small pools with copious crowds of drinking adults and littered beach. Even though my room was completely remodeled I will be finding other accommodation in the future even without kids. Everything outside of room just felt dirty overall. I have zero desire risking roaches, needle sticks, cut hands from beach glass.

I see a lot of reviews that are either amazing or terrible (usually from one specific bad thing that happened). So I thought I'd write an honest, unbiased review from a six-time Sands guest. Based on others' reviews, I should begin by saying - if you are looking for a quiet, relaxing getaway, DON'T stay here. If you want an exciting, lively family vacation/couple's trip, this is the place for you. There are two bars - one indoors that has karaoke every night, and one outside that has a cover band playing - yes - every night. People WILL shoot fireworks on the beach; the hotel is not responsible for that (those people might not even be staying there). The rooms are great, but could be a little cleaner. Please keep in mind, the decor, furniture, dishes, etc. can vary from room to room, as the condos are independently owned. We've had everything from a beautifully decorated room to a completely empty, bare-essential room. But who cares, we're on the beach all day anyway! As far as the cleanliness, almost every year I've found hair in the shower, the tubs or sink won't drain, sometimes the inside of toilets aren't that clean, and some of the carpets are dated. But it's nothing that ruins our stay by any means. I've never personally experienced bed bugs, so can't confirm or deny that one. There are what looks like roaches crawling around the ground, but please note, they are just palmetto bugs. They are common in all oceanfront properties. One year we had a one bedroom suite on the ground floor and there was a (dead) palmetto bug (and the air conditioning didn't work). The staff immediately upgraded our room to a two bedroom suite on the fifth floor instead. That being said, some years the staff hasn't been fantastic. Our last trip was two weeks ago and we were blessed [sarcasm] with a room that had one of those doors connecting to the room next to you. We had just about the most unpleasant neighbors, where a drunk man was screaming at his kids and yelling "WOO" every five minutes in the middle of the night. I called to complain (the "quiet time" begins at 11PM); she said she would take care of it, but the neighbors were still unpleasant for the next two nights. Pick your battles, I guess. However, the bell boys are the best! So friendly and funny, one gave our toddler a toy on the way in - he has a whole bag full for kids. The maintenance guys are helpful and quick, we've had issues with TV remotes, hot water, light bulbs, etc. They always get it taken care of. The perks and amenities are great, you get free lunch Sun-Thurs and free water park tickets to Wild Water and Wheels (during the regular season). The pools, lazy river and hot tubs are fun and clean. If you enjoy the live music at night, one of the pools is front and center to Ocean Annie's Beach Bar. A very nice man runs the convenient store and gift shop downstairs. He has everything you may have forgotten, dish soap, paper towels, condiments, etc. along with ice cream! All in all, I personally give Sands 5 stars - it's our home away from home.
